Instructions
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
In a large mixing bowl, mash bananas. Next, stir in melted coconut oil and honey. Add egg, baking soda, cinnamon, salt, and vanilla, mixing well.
Add in oats and flour and mix until well combined. (Add any optional mix-ins like chocolate morsels. See notes for suggestions)
Spread mixture in a parchment-lined 8x8 inch baking dish. Bake in the preheated oven for about 25-30 minutes or until golden brown and bars are set.
Remove from the oven and let the bars cool completely in the baking dish. Once cooled, lift the parchment paper with the bars from the dish and transfer them to a cutting board.
Optional Peanut Butter Topping
Once cooled, you can melt melting the peanut butter and white chocolate in a small bowl in the microwave for 30 seconds at a time until soft. Then, place it in a sandwich baggie and drizzle it over the top of the bars. Enjoy!
Notes
ADD-INS: Feel free to customize the recipe by adding your favorite ingredients, such as chia seeds, dark chocolate chips, or spices like nutmeg or ginger. The possibilities for delicious add-ins are endless! Dried fruit, shredded coconut, chocolate, caramel, nuts, and M&Ms all work!PAN: Use an 8-inch square baking dish for the recipe or if you'd like thinner bars, use a 9-inch square. Remember to line your pan with parchment paper so the bars come out of the baking dish easily!OATS. We recommend using old-fashioned oats instead of instant or quick oats in this oatmeal banana bar recipe for optimal results. Using quick oats may result in overly dense bars.You can cut the bars into 9 or 16 squares, depending on your preference. To Freeze: Bake as directed and allow them to cool completely. Cut into bars, then wrap individually in foil or plastic. Place wrapped bars in a freezer bag for later. Thaw for at least one hour before eating.To Store: Layer the bars between waxed paper in an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for 3 - 5 days.
